Design 35 Edlu

Edlu was built by Henry B. Nevins of City Island, New York and launched in 1934. She was designed and built for Rudolph J. Schaefer. She is a very typical design for the period from this office. Edlu was a notorious race winner.

She was reconfigured in 1936 as a yawl. I have attached an image with her new rig. Her ballast was also increased to compensate for the additional sail area.

It looks like she was again re-rigged in 1963. Heres the revised sail plan. Looks like the bowsprit was reduced in length. Note the potential hard dodger shown.

LOA 56-2"
LWL 40-0"
Beam 13-0"
Draft 7-10"
Displacement 47,100 lbs
Sail Area 1,143 sq ft
